Property Description

Stately Colonial End-Unit with Modern Updates in Historic LeDroit Park 1854 2nd Street NW | Washington, DC 20001 This stunning 3-bedroom, 3.5-bath Colonial-style end-unit is a rare gem in historic LeDroit Park. Built in 1911, this home offers 2,335 square feet of living space filled with light, warmth, and timeless charm. Main Living Space Beautiful hardwood floors, recessed lighting, and exposed brick create an inviting ambiance, while large windows flood the home with natural light from every angle. Despite the abundance of light, the home retains a private and peaceful feel thanks to its end-unit position, set back on the lot with a side yard and two rear porches offering tranquil views of Anna J. Cooper Circle. The main level boasts an open, light-filled living and dining area, with a half bath conveniently located for guests. Bedrooms Primary Bedroom: The luxurious primary suite features vaulted ceilings soaring up to 20 feet, revealing stunning period architectural windows that bathe the space in even more natural light. Soaking tub and stand up shower, in the huge en suite bathroom. Guest Room: The spacious guest room includes a walk-out balcony, perfect for enjoying morning coffee or fresh air. Ensuite bathroom. Basement Suite The large basement level is a standout feature, complete with a full kitchen, windows throughout, and a private entrance, making it perfect as a guest suite, in-law quarters, or an income-producing rental. It also connects to the main house for added flexibility. En suite bathroom Kitchens The upper-level kitchen is appointed with granite countertops and ample space for meal prep and entertainment, while the basement kitchen offers its own fully equipped space for independent living or extended stays. Outdoor Space The spacious backyard opens onto a drivable alley, providing easy access and an opportunity for off-street parking. With plenty of space for planting your dream garden or hosting outdoor dining and entertainment, this backyard is a rare find in the heart of the city. Location & Neighborhood LeDroit Park is not only known for its stunning architecture and tree-lined streets but also for its rich history. This neighborhood has been home to some of the greatest leaders, thinkers, and cultural icons of the 20th and 21st centuries. Living here means joining a community steeped in heritage and creativity, with close proximity to parks, top dining options, and the vibrant cultural landmarks of Washington, DC.
